Prevalence of generative artificial intelligence sexualized image usage by adolescents in the United States
1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ering, George Mason University, Fairfax, Virginia, United States of America.
Abstract:
The prevalence of generative artificial intelligence (GenAI) usage related to sexualized images amongst adolescents is a critical emerging research area. In this exploratory study, a nationally representative online survey of 557 English-speaking individuals aged 13-17 was conducted. Participants were asked about their consensual and non-consensual usage and interactions with sexualized GenAI images. The survey included questions on images created with nudification software as well as content creation software, and asked participants about their creation, sharing, and viewing of this content, as well as that of their peers. Use of nudification tools was widespread, with 55.3% (n = 308) of participants reporting having created and 54.4% (n = 303) having received at least one image. Reported victimization levels of participants was substantial, with 36.3% (n = 202) of individuals reporting having a non-consensual image created and 33.2% (n = 185) of individuals having had at least one image non-consensually shared. Usage was similar across demographic categories, though male participants had higher degrees of regular GenAI sexual image creation and distribution, both consensual and non-consensual. Policymakers need to consider the extensive usage and its normalization and consider educational interventions, and practitioners need to be aware of the high degree and nature of victimization occurring.
